Sony Music Publishing and Warner Chappell Music have jointly sued Anthropic, the developer of Claude's LLMs. The lawsuit alleges that tens of thousands of copyrighted songs were used without permission to train Anthropic's large language models. Dario Amodei and Benjamin Mann are also named in the suit, which claims copyright infringement by the AI company.
